Dynamic Data Networks (DDN) are a cutting-edge approach to network management that prioritizes flexibility, efficiency, and security. Unlike traditional static networks, DDNs are designed to adapt to changing conditions in real-time, optimizing data flow and resource allocation. By dynamically adjusting network configurations based on traffic patterns, security threats, and performance requirements, DDNs can deliver significant improvements in both operational efficiency and data security.

Overcoming Challenges in Deploying and Running Dynamic Facts Networks





While Dynamic Data Networks (DDNs) offer significant benefits, there are challenges associated with their deployment and management that organizations must address. One common challenge is ensuring interoperability and seamless integration with existing network infrastructure and legacy systems. Organizations need to carefully plan the migration to DDNs, ensuring that compatibility issues are mitigated and that existing investments in networking equipment are leveraged effectively.

Another challenge is the complexity of managing dynamic network configurations and policies within DDNs. Organizations must invest in robust management platforms that provide centralized visibility and control over the entire network infrastructure. Automation tools and orchestration frameworks can also help streamline the management of dynamic policies and configurations, reducing the administrative burden on IT teams.

Additionally, ensuring compliance with regulatory requirements and industry standards presents a challenge when deploying DDNs. Organizations must carefully assess the impact of dynamic network changes on compliance obligations and implement mechanisms to maintain adherence to relevant regulations.
